In Conversation with Michael Landy

Join us for an evening with artist Michael Landy, CBE, RA.

Landy will share previous works – including Breakdown (2001) an Artangel commission in which he catalogued and destroyed all 7,227 of his worldly possessions in a disused department store on Oxford Street, and Acts of Kindness (2011) for Art on the Underground – as part of the artistic context for his proposal for the Humanitarian Aid Memorial at Gunnersbury Park.

The evening will continue with a round table discussion between Landy, Humanitarian Aid Committee members Sir John Holmes and Sir Brendan Gormley, Gunnersbury Museum and Park Development Trust's, David Bowler and Contemporary Art Society Senior Art Producer, Jordan Kaplan, which will open up to attendees for a more informal conversation over drinks and canapés.


This is a free event but booking is essential
